From the Triodion

Nailed to the Cross, O Lord, You destroyed the curse of Adam with the divine spear. Destroy my bonds, O Word, that I may offer You a sacrifice of joy and praise in faith during this acceptable time of the Fast which You have appointed for the salvation of all.

Once in the ecstasy of fasting, the face of Moses shone as he beheld the glory of God. O my humble soul, follow his example. By works of abstinence and prayer, serve Him who stretched out His hands upon the Cross, that He may grant you a share in His divine joy.

From O Lord, to You I Call, Vespers, Friday, Fifth Week of Lent

By my own free will, through my first transgression, I have forsaekn the beauty of the virtues; but through Your loving condescension, O Word of God, I am clothed with that beauty once again. Though I was defiled by grievous passions and thieves had left me wounded on the road, yet You have not despised me; but You kept me safe by Your almight power, granting me Your aid, O merciful Lord!

From the Aposticha, Vespers, Friday, Fifth Week of Lent
